Hi Prafulla,
This one was a bit of a judgement call.
You are absolutely correct in what you say that Kirkwood supports two, but
to the best of my knowledge, no one has yet implemented a board using
both busses (I am not that familiar with OpenRD, I may have to eat my
words).
For the sheevaplug, guruplug & dreamplug, it is definitely the case that
only
one device can be attached.
